Man Breaks Into Harlem Apartment By Climbing Through Window

August 16, 2016

2348-16_32_pct_burg_7-30-16_photo2_of_individual-1471386355-1047Police are searching for a man they say broke into a Harlem apartment but left without stealing anything.

The man climbed a fire escape and crawled through the window of an apartment on Saint Nicholas Avenue near 140th Street on July 30, police told Patch. But then the man fled the apartment without stealing anything, police said.

Police describe the man — who was filmed by a security camera on the residential building — as bald, wearing a long-sleeved white shirt, black jeans and white sneakers. He is pictured above this article.
